林木半同胞子代测定遗传模型分析  被引量:26

Analysis of Genetic Model for Half-Sib Progeny Test in Forest Trees

摘  要:针对林木单地点半同胞子代测定试验,给出遗传模型不同形式的表达式,采用方差分析法推导平衡数据和不平衡数据条件下方差分量估计式,并给出方差分量估计的抽样方差以及方差分量假设检验统计量的计算方法。在此基础上,给出不平衡数据条件下家系遗传力的计算公式以及家系遗传力和单株遗传力抽样方差近似计算方法。对于2个数量性状,给出不平衡数据条件下遗传相关系数估计式,而且还给出遗传相关系数估计的方差近似计算方法。用VC++6.0编写计算单地点半同胞子代测定模型中各种遗传参数的Windows应用软件。In this paper, different expressions of a genetic model were presented for the half-sib progeny test of forest trees at a single site. Formulas of estimating the variance components were derived by using ANOVA method for both balanced data and unbalanced data based on the genetic model, and the procedures were also given for calculating sampling variances of the estimators and the statistic for hypothesis test of variance components. Furthermore, a formula of family heritability was given for unbalanced data, and the procedures to calculate sampling variances of family heritability and single tree heritability were also described. For any two quantitative traits, the methods to calculate the genetic correlation coefficient and its sampling variance were presented. Finally, a Windows software was developed to calculate all the parameters of the genetic model and can be freely used by forest breeders.
